Hey Mira,

Handing over the Tidewell calendar release. The sync-conflict fix is merged but don't ship until the dedupe job finishes tonight — otherwise users see duplicate events again. Staging looks clean. The release pipeline will prompt you to sign the build, so use the deploy key below.

Cheers, Osvald

deploy key for kajof-fajop: bky6_gDHw9Q

Runbook — Firmware Channel Rollout (Osprey Devices, Lanternwood fleet). When promoting a firmware build from the beta channel to stable, first verify that the canary cohort has reported a success rate above 99% for 24 hours in the Osprey console. Pause the updater if more than two devices report a rollback. Promotions outside the maintenance window require sign-off from the fleet lead. Before initiating the promotion, confirm the channel daemon on the coordinator node is running with the expected settings, which are the following:

config for bahop-fajep:
DRUATH_PIN=4501
DRUATH_TENANT=briwyn
DRUATH_METRICS_HOST=metrics.druath.brasksoft.test
DRUATH_SEAL=seal_7d2e069d
DRUATH_STANDBY_TEAM=olieth

## Deployment

The Tarridge tax-rate lookup cache deploys as a single stateless container behind the internal gateway. It holds no customer data, only jurisdiction rate tables refreshed hourly from the rates service. Outbound access is restricted to that one endpoint. Review the runtime configuration below before approving promotion to production.

settings of tagef-bawif:
DRUIX_HOST=druix.zemvarlabs.internal
DRUIX_PORT=8000